您从未使用过的前16种Java工具中的哪一种?

来源:https://www.programcreek.com/在Java中,实用程序类是一个类,它定义了一组执行常用功能的方法。本文介绍了最常用的Java实用程序类及其最常用的方法。
类列表及其方法列表按受欢迎程度排序。数据基于从GitHub随机选择的50,000个开放源Java项目。
我希望您可以浏览列表以了解一些已提供并流行的功能的想法,从而使您知道自己不需要实现它们。这些方法的名称通常指示它们的作用。
如果方法名称不够直观,您还可以查看其他开发人员如何在其开源项目中使用它们。 org.apache.commons.io.IOUtils closeQuietly()toString()copy()toByteArray()write()toInputStream()readLines()copyLarge()lineIterator()readFully()org.apache.commons.io.FileUtils deleteDirectory( ))ReadFileToString()deleteQuietly()copyFile()writeStringToFile()forceMkdir()write()listFiles()copyDirectory()forceDelete()org.apache.commons.lang.StringUtils isBlank()lang.StringUtils isBlank()Notequals(Notequals) )()join()split()EMPTY trimToNull()replace()org.apache.http.util.EntityUtils toString()consume()toByteArray()consumeQuietly()getContentCharSet())IsNotBlank()isEmpty()isNotEmpty() join()equals()split()EMPTY replace()capitalize()org.apache.commons.io.FilenameUtils getExtension()getExtension()getExtension()getExtension()getExtension()getExtension()nsion()normalize()wildcardMatch ()eparatorsToUnix()getFullPath()isExtension()org.springframework.util.StringUtils hasText()hasLength()isEmpty()commaDelimited(StringDeStringListToStringArray()commaDeli mited(StringDeString)collectionToDeStringListToStringArray()()tokenizeToStringArray()org.apache.commons.lang.ArrayUtils contains()addAll()clone()isEmpty()add()EMPTY_BYTE_ARRAY子数组()indexOf()isEquals()。
toObject() isEquals()。toObject()isEquals()。
toObject()StringEscapeUtilsscapeHtml()unescapeHtml()escapeXml()escapeSql()unescapeJava()escapeJava()escapeJavaScript()unescapeXml()unescapeJavaScript()org.apache.http.client。 utils.URLEncodedUtils格式(通用)org.apache.http.client.utils.URLEncodedUtils(通用).codec.digest.DigestUtils md5Hex()shaHex()sha256Hex()sha1Hex()sha()md5()sha512Hex()sh a1 ()org.apache.commons.collections.CollectionUtils isEmpty()isNotEmpty()select()transform()filter()find()collect()forAllDo()addAll()isEqualCollection()org.apache.commons.lang 3。
ArrayUtils contains()isEmpty()isNotEmpty()add()clone()addAll()subarray()indexOf()EMPTY_OBJECT_ARRAY EMPTY_STRING_ARRAY EMPTY_STRING_ARRAY org.apache.commons.beans getProperti es(ReadProperties(ReadProperties)(ReadProperty))GetPropertyDescriptor()getSimpleProperty()isWriteable()setSimpleProperty()getPropertyType()org.apache.commons.lang3.StringEscapeUtils unescapeHtml4()escapeHtmlscape(JscapeX) )JavaEscape()EscapeXml(JscapeXml)()org.apache.commons.beanutils.BeanUtils copyProperties()getProperty()setProperty()describe()populate()copyProperty()cloneBean()我特别推荐一种高质量的内容共享架构+算法。如果您没有关注,则可以长按以关注它:长按以订阅更多令人兴奋的内容▼如果您已获得关注,请单击以查看,衷心感谢您的免责声明:本文内容经授权后发布版权归21ic所有,版权归原作者所有。
该平台仅提供信息存储服务。本文仅代表作者的个人观点,并不代表该平台的立场。
如有任何疑问,请与我们联系,谢谢!

公司: 深圳市捷比信实业有限公司

电话: 0755-29796190

邮箱: tao@jepsun.com

产品经理: 陆经理

QQ: 2065372476

地址: 深圳市宝安区翻身路富源大厦1栋7楼

微信二维码

更多资讯

获取最新公司新闻和行业资料。

  • 如何根据实际需求选择合适的电阻阵列:CN..A、SWR..A与CRW..A系列深度指南 前言:电阻阵列在现代电子设计中的重要性随着电子产品向小型化、高性能和高可靠性方向发展,传统单个电阻已难以满足复杂电路的设计需求。电阻阵列作为一种集成化解决方案,不仅节省了PCB空间,还提升了装配效率与一致...
  • 五向开关DC12(V)0.05(A):应用与技术参数 五向开关DC12(V)0.05(A)是一种电子元件,它在电路设计和设备控制中发挥着重要作用。这种开关通常用于需要控制多个方向或功能的应用场景,例如遥控器、游戏控制器或是小型电子设备的导航按钮等。五向开关能够提供上、...
  • 深入解析电阻阵列CN..A系列与SWR..A系列、CRW..A系列的核心差异 引言在电子元器件领域,电阻阵列因其高集成度、稳定性和空间节省优势,广泛应用于精密电路、工业控制及通信设备中。其中,CN..A系列、SWR..A系列和CRW..A系列是市场上常见的三种电阻阵列型号。尽管它们均属于电阻阵列类别,...
  • 深入解析CRW..A系列与SWR..A系列电阻器在电力系统中的关键作用 CRW..A系列与SWR..A系列在电力系统中的核心价值随着智能电网与新能源接入系统的快速发展,电力设备对过压保护的需求日益增强。浪涌电阻器作为第一道防线,其性能直接关系到系统安全与运行连续性。本文将从技术原理、实际...
  • 浪涌电阻器SWR..A系列与CRW..A系列性能对比及应用解析 浪涌电阻器SWR..A系列与CRW..A系列概述浪涌电阻器是电子电路中用于抑制瞬态过电压、保护敏感元器件的重要元件。其中,SWR..A系列与CRW..A系列作为当前市场主流产品,凭借优异的耐冲击能力、高稳定性与长寿命,在工业控制、电...
  • 抗硫电阻AS..A系列与CS..A系列参数详解及应用优势分析 抗硫电阻AS..A系列与CS..A系列核心参数解析在工业自动化、石油化工、电力系统等高腐蚀环境中,电子元器件的可靠性至关重要。抗硫电阻(AS..A系列、CS..A系列)因其优异的耐硫化环境性能,成为关键电路中的首选元件。1. 基本电...
  • 深入解析耐脉冲电阻阻值范围:如何根据PWR..A与CRW..A系列精准选型 耐脉冲电阻阻值范围的重要性在电子系统设计中,电阻不仅是基础元件,更是决定电路稳定性和安全性的重要因素。尤其是耐脉冲电阻,其阻值范围直接影响系统的过压保护能力、电流限制效果以及热耗散效率。本文将重点分析...
  • 耐脉冲电阻PWR..A系列与CRW..A系列阻值范围详解及应用解析 耐脉冲电阻PWR..A系列与CRW..A系列概述耐脉冲电阻是专为应对瞬时高能量脉冲设计的精密电子元件,广泛应用于电源管理、电机控制、通信设备及工业自动化系统中。其中,PWR..A系列与CRW..A系列是目前市场上备受青睐的两款高性能...
  • 深入解析抗硫电阻AS..A系列与CS..A系列的选型与设计要点 抗硫电阻选型指南:AS..A系列与CS..A系列实战应用策略面对复杂工业环境中的电磁干扰与化学腐蚀挑战,正确选择抗硫电阻是保障系统长期稳定运行的关键。本文从设计角度出发,系统梳理AS..A系列与CS..A系列的选型要点。1. 环境条...
  • 深入解读抗硫电阻AS..A系列:从材料到应用的全面指南 抗硫电阻AS..A系列的技术原理与材料创新抗硫电阻的核心挑战在于防止硫元素渗透并引发氧化反应,导致阻值变化甚至失效。AS..A系列通过多项材料与工艺创新,从根本上解决了这一难题。材料与结构创新陶瓷基底 + 高纯度金属膜...
  • 高压电阻器HVR..A系列与CR..A系列耐高温电阻的性能对比与应用解析 高压电阻器HVR..A系列与CR..A系列耐高温电阻的性能对比与应用解析在现代电子系统中,高压和高温环境下的稳定运行对元器件提出了极高要求。高压电阻器HVR..A系列与CR..A系列耐高温电阻正是为应对这些严苛工况而设计的高性能元...
  • 如何正确选型与维护高压电阻器HVR..A系列及CR..A系列耐高温电阻 如何正确选型与维护高压电阻器HVR..A系列及CR..A系列耐高温电阻随着工业自动化与高端电子设备的发展,高压与高温环境下的电阻器选型与维护成为保障系统可靠性的关键环节。本文将系统阐述如何科学选型,并提供实用的维护策...
  • 厚膜电阻器CR..A系列与薄膜精密电阻器AR..A系列的性能对比分析 厚膜电阻器CR..A系列与薄膜精密电阻器AR..A系列核心差异解析在现代电子设备中,电阻器作为基础元件,其性能直接影响电路的稳定性与精度。其中,厚膜电阻器(CR..A系列)与薄膜精密电阻器(AR..A系列)因其制造工艺与材料特性...
  • CR..A系列电阻器参数详解:从阻值到封装全面指南 CR..A系列电阻器关键参数深度解析CR..A系列作为汽车电子领域广泛应用的贴片电阻型号,其参数设计兼顾性能、可靠性和兼容性,是工程师选型的重要参考。1. 标称阻值范围与精度等级支持从1Ω到10MΩ的广泛阻值选择,标准精度等...
  • 音响电阻主要有哪些种类 音响电阻主要有种类:1.金属膜电阻:它具有噪声低、耐高温、体积小、稳定性高、精度高等特点,缺点是价格昂贵。这些电阻对音响的音质也有很大影响。2.碳膜电阻:稳定性相对较高,噪声相对较低,但电阻比金属膜差它价格...
  • 如何根据电路需求选择CR..A系列厚膜电阻器与AR..A系列薄膜电阻器 从电路设计角度深度解析电阻器选型策略在实际电路设计中,正确选择电阻器类型是保障系统性能的关键一步。面对市场上常见的厚膜电阻器(CR..A系列)与薄膜精密电阻器(AR..A系列),工程师需结合具体应用场景进行综合评估...
  • 低温漂精密电阻都有哪些种类? 低温漂贴片电阻低温漂插件电阻低温漂金属膜电阻低温漂大功率电阻低温漂采样电阻低温漂电阻指的是电阻阻值在温度变化时阻值的变化,阻值变化率越小,电阻的稳定性越高。低温漂电阻的变化一般用TCR(ppm/℃)表示,下图为...
  • 自恢复保险丝的使用过程中需要注意哪些事项? 在使用自恢复保险丝的过程中需要注意以下几点:选择合适的额定电压和电流:应根据被保护电路的额定电压和电流选择合适的自恢复保险丝,以确保保险丝能够在过流或短路故障时正常工作。避免误用:应避免将自恢复保险丝...
  • 深入对比:WAN1608H245H08 vs H04 —— 哪款更适合您的工业项目? 前言:型号差异背后的逻辑在工业通信模块选型过程中,型号后缀的细微差别往往隐藏着重大性能差异。本文聚焦于 WAN1608H245H08 与 WAN1608H245H04 的对比,揭示二者在硬件配置、功能扩展与应用场景上的根本区别,助力工程师精准匹...
  • 如何正确使用与选型CS..A系列电流检测贴片电阻?实用指南 CS..A系列贴片电阻使用与选型全攻略随着电子产品向微型化、智能化发展,对电流检测元件的性能要求日益提高。CS..A系列作为新一代电流检测片式电阻,其设计与应用需遵循科学方法,以确保系统稳定性和测量准确性。关键选型...